Proxies

A member entitled to attend and vote at this Meeting is entitled to appoint not more than 2 proxies to attend and vote in his/her stead.

A proxy need not be a member of the Company.

If the member appoints 2 proxies, the member may specify the proportion or number of votes each proxy is entitled to exercise. If no proportion or number of votes is specified, each proxy may exercise half of the votes. If the specified proportion or number of votes exceeds that which the member is entitled to, each proxy may exercise half of the member’s votes. Any fractions of votes brought about by the apportionment of votes to a proxy will be disregarded.

Item 1: Financial Statements and Reports

This item allows members the opportunity to consider the Financial Statements, Directors’ Report and Auditors’ Report of the Company. Under Section 317 of the Corporations Act the Company is required to lay these reports that together comprise the Company’s Annual Report before its members at its Annual General Meeting.

Item 2: Re-election of Director

Under the Company’s constitution one third of the Company’s Directors or the number nearest to one-third, of the Company’s longest serving Directors since the last election or re-election, and not including a Director appointed by the remaining Directors either to fill a casual vacancy or as an addition to the existing Directors, must retire unless re-elected. Each retiring Director is eligible for re-election in accordance with ASX Listing Rules and the Company’s constitution.

Resolution 1 provides for the re-election of Matthew Kidman as Director of the Company in accordance with the Company’s constitution.

Item 3: Adoption of Remuneration Report

Resolution 2 provides members the opportunity to vote on the Company’s Remuneration Report. Under Section 250R(2) of the Corporations Act, the Company must put the adoption of its Remuneration Report to the vote at its Annual General Meeting. The Remuneration Report is contained in the Directors’ Report. This vote is advisory only and does not bind the Directors or the Company.

The board will consider the outcome of the vote and comments made by shareholders on the remuneration report at this meeting when reviewing the Company’s remuneration policies. If 25% or more of the votes that are cast are voted against the adoption of the remuneration report at two consecutive annual general meetings shareholders will be required to vote at the second of those annual general meetings on a resolution (a “spill resolution”) that another meeting be held within 90 days at which all of the Company’s directors other than the managing director must go up for election. The spill resolution is an ordinary resolution.

In respect of the Remuneration Report resolution, key management personnel (whose remuneration details are included in the Remuneration Report) and their closely related parties must not cast a vote on the Remuneration Report, unless as holders of directed proxies for shareholders eligible to vote on Resolution 2.

Key management personnel of the Company are identified as the Chairman and Directors of the Company. Their closely related parties are defined in the Corporations Act 2001, and include certain of their family members, dependants and companies they control.
